The eyepiece tube is the long tube that connects the eyepiece and ocular lens to the objective lens.The control knobs are the knobs on the side of the microscope that are used to change the position of the objective lenses and bring the slides into better focus.The stage clips are the metal clips on either side of the stage that are used to hold the slides in place. The stage is the platform where you put the slides you're using the microscope to look at.For best results, use a microfiber cloth.Avoid bringing your damp cloth too close to the lenses of the microscope, especially when you're cleaning around the eyepiece.
